My stats are +2 Bold, +1 Good, -1 Strong, 0 Wary, +1 Weird. I am fearless and a talented counselor, but am no warrior and am perhaps as easily fooled as my ancestors.
RIGHTS
- I have the right to due respect from all.
- I have the right to exhilarate and intoxicate when I win someone over, instead of asking a question, I may fill them with hope, kindness, love, mercy or faith; I may require from them a boon which may not be refused; I may leave them in despair, longing or regret.
- I have the right to be recognized as one of the Old Blood. I am to be given fitting tribute and recognition from all the rivers of Britain; I may bind warriors to my service with oaths and blood rites; I may solemnize the turning of the seasons and the bonds between our worlds.
- I have the right to receive gifts and offerings on behalf of the waters of Britain.
OBLIGATIONS
- I am obligated to care for the sword Excalibur until I find a rightful wielder, and to not let any unworthy destroy themselves by trying to draw it from the scabbard.
- I am obligated to care for the waters of the duchy; to see them cleansed when they are fouled, to see them honored and fruitful, to bring forth the mists in their proper seasons.
- I am obligated to care for my companions, Tybalt and Palug. I am to leave food for them, to hold them when they demand it, to scratch them behind their ears, and to let them roam the night as they please.
BELONGINGS
- I wear a pale blue gown with a belt of pearls and bronze links. My feet are bare upon the earth. My hair is knotted about an ancient comb of the Old People, made of polished bronze.
- My drinking cup is a gift given to the water, made of tarnished bronze, two-handled.
- My knife is made of flint, old as the hills, antler-handled.
- I may dredge from the river arms as I see appropriate: mail and sword, shield and helm. They are bronze, the fine ones, and of iron or the wild otherwise.
HOUSEHOLD
- I am head of my household. (My cats disagree.)
- I have a lake, a sacred shrine which I tend, orchards and woods which I keep, and a numinous reputation. (My larder is ever half-full of gifts.)
- I am on the far side of the lake from Bywater, and one must take a journey by wood or water to reach me.
